HIGH-SPEED MOBILE APPS - AN OVERVIEW

High-Speed Mobile Apps - An Overview

High-Speed Mobile Apps - An Overview

Blog Article

Exactly how to Develop a Mobile Application: A Beginner's Overview
The idea of developing a mobile app can be interesting but additionally overwhelming, particularly for newbies. Whether you're an entrepreneur aiming to introduce a start-up or a developer excited to develop your very first application, the process includes cautious preparation, design, advancement, and advertising and marketing. This guide will stroll you through the crucial steps to turn your app concept right into fact.

Action 1: Define Your App Idea and Goals
Every successful application begins with a clear objective. Ask on your own:

What trouble does my app fix?
That is my target market?
What special attributes will establish my application in addition to rivals?
Conduct marketing research to confirm your idea. Look at comparable applications in your sector, recognize their toughness and weak points, and gather user feedback to understand what potential customers desire.

Action 2: Select an Advancement Approach
There are 3 main ways to develop a mobile application:

Indigenous Apps-- Constructed especially for iphone (Swift) or Android (Kotlin). These apps supply the very best performance yet need separate advancement for each system.
Cross-Platform Apps-- Created utilizing structures like Flutter or Respond Indigenous, enabling the same codebase to service both iOS and Android.
No-Code/Low-Code Applications-- Tools like Adalo or Bubble allow users with little to no coding experience to produce applications.
Choose a technique based on your spending plan, technical experience, and long-lasting objectives.

Action 3: Design the User Interface (UI) and Individual Experience (UX).
An aesthetically appealing and user friendly user interface is crucial for an app's success. Secret factors to consider consist of:.

Navigating: Ensure individuals can access functions promptly and intuitively.
Color scheme and branding: Use consistent design elements that align with your brand.
Responsiveness: Ensure the app works well across different devices and screen sizes.
Prototyping devices like Figma or Adobe XD can aid develop mockups prior to beginning advancement.

Step 4: Establish the App.
Once your design prepares, the growth phase begins. If you're coding the app on your own, damage the process into these key parts:.

Front-End Growth: The user-facing part of the app, consisting of style and functionality.
Back-End Development: Server-side procedures like database monitoring, customer authentication, and cloud storage.
API Assimilation: Connecting the application to third-party services such as settlement entrances, social media systems, or analytics tools.
For newbies, hiring a growth team or making use of app home builders can speed up the procedure.

Tip 5: Test and Debug the Application.
Prior to releasing, extensive screening is essential to guarantee the application operates smoothly. Focus on:.

Efficiency Screening: Checking tons times and responsiveness.
Use Screening: Getting comments from genuine individuals.
Security Testing: Determining vulnerabilities that might place user data at risk.
Evaluating tools like TestFlight (for iphone) and Firebase Examination Laboratory (for Android) can assist find and deal with concerns prior to release.

Action 6: Release and Market Your Application.
As soon as screening is full, submit your app to the Apple App Store and Google Play Shop. Prepare:.

An engaging app summary.
High-grade screenshots and advertising video clips.
ASO (Application Store Optimization) strategies to increase presence.
After launch, advertise your app through social media, influencer collaborations, and paid advertising and marketing to draw in individuals.

Final Ideas.
Developing a mobile app is a fulfilling however challenging trip. By complying with these steps, newbies can improve the development procedure and increase their opportunities of success. The key is continual improvement-- screen user comments, repair pests, and update your application frequently to remain relevant get more info in a progressing market.

Report this page